Heights of Horseshoe Snowboarding

Halfpipes: 1
Tarrain Parks: 1

Improved terrain park, our half pipe is 10 metres wide at the base, 17.5 metre wide at the top, 3.5 metres deep and is approximately 80 metres long at a 20 degree pitch.
